Basic Concepts:
- Understanding the Computer: An introduction to what a computer is and its basic components, such as the monitor, keyboard, mouse, and CPU (Central Processing Unit).
- Identifying the Power Button: Teaching children how to locate the power button on a desktop or laptop. This might include visual aids or diagrams to help them recognize the symbol for power (often a circle with a line).
Step-by-Step Instructions:
- The tutorial would likely break down the process of starting a computer into simple, clear steps:
- Locate the Power Button: Show where the button is on different types of computers.
- Press the Power Button: Instruct on how to press the button gently and understand that this turns on the device.
- Wait for Boot Up: Explain that it takes a moment for the computer to start up, during which they might see a logo or loading screen.
- Log In (if required): If applicable, a simple explanation of entering a password or selecting a user account.

Turning Off the Computer:
- The tutorial would also cover the importance of shutting down a computer properly, which protects its software and hardware. Steps could include:
- Click on the Start Menu: Showing how to find the shutdown option on Windows or similar tasks on Macs and other operating systems.
- Select the Shutdown Option: Teaching the students what it means to "shut down" and why it’s important.
